The B&R ACOPOSmulti SafeMOTION EnDat 2.2 Gen2 inverter module designed for high-performance motion control in demanding environments. It features a Compact design and offers modular expandability through virtual wiring, enabling immediate triggering of safety functions with short cycle times. The inverter is optimised for applications requiring decentralised, computationally intensive open-loop and closed-loop control, providing full safety functionality even in dual-axis configurations. This innovative solution enhances overall system efficiency while maintaining rigorous safety standards.

Modular expandability allows for versatile setups and easy adjustments

Immediate triggering of safety functions ensures Rapid response times

Compact design facilitates integration into space-constrained environments

Complete safety functionality even in two-axis configurations enhances reliability

Optimised for decentralised control systems, meeting complex computational needs

Easy implementation with transparent control and status information simplifies operations

Supports industry-standard communication protocols for seamless integration
